What to Expect During Cataract Surgery?
Cataract surgical treatment normally lasts about 15 to 30 minutes and is carried out on an outpatient basis.
You'll reach the clinic and obtain eye drops to expand your students. An anesthetic might be administered to guarantee you fit.
Throughout https://www.dovepress.com/corneal-donation-current-guidelines-and-future-direction-peer-reviewed-fulltext-article-OPTH , your cosmetic surgeon will certainly make a little incision in your eye, get rid of the cloudy lens, and replace it with a man-made one. You could see some lights or darkness but will not really feel pain.
After the surgical procedure, you'll rest briefly in a healing area prior to heading home. It's important to have a person drive you, as your vision may be fuzzy.
You'll obtain instructions for post-operative care, consisting of eye decreases and follow-up consultations to monitor your healing.
